Henry Joe Cooper was born in 1905 in Hugo, Choctaw, Oklahoma, USA, the child of Thomas Cooper And Emily Emma Moore. In 1930, Henry Joe Cooper resided in Wilson, Choctaw, Oklahoma, USA. In 1935, Henry Joe Cooper resided in Rural, Carter, Oklahoma. Henry Joe Cooper married Lear Lela Mae Crosby, and had children including Lucille Cooper. Henry Joe Cooper passed away in 1996 in Spencer, Oklahoma County, Oklahoma, United States of America.
